Premier League | Arsenal sign Martin Odegaard on loan from Real Madrid

 

Arsenal have acquired the services of Real Madrid midfielder Martin Odegaard on loan for the remainder of this season.

The 22-year-old wasn’t able to impress Zinedine Zidane during his stint for Real Madrid but he will be hoping to make up for it with good performances for Arsenal.

It has been also learnt that Ajax and Real Sociedad, where he went on loan last season, were also interested in getting Odegaard on board.

Arsenal boss Mikel Arteta looked very happy with his new signing.

“Martin is of course a player we all know very well. Although still young, he has been playing at the top level for a while,” Arteta was quoted as saying in a statement.

Arteta also mentioned that Odegaard can provide then with quality offensive options and it has been also indicated that he can feature in the game against Manchester United on Saturday.

Odegaard also shared his thoughts about Arteta,”He seems like a top manager and I liked his ideas, the way he sees football and also the way he is. He gave me a great feeling and that was important for me to come here. He was crucial.

“I think it’s a club that really suits me well.”

Odegaard is arriving at the Emirates Stadium after Mesut Ozil’s departure from the club to Fenerbahce.

The Norwegian had joined Real Madrid from Stromgodset in 2015. He made nine appearances for Real Madrid this season.

He grew as a player during his loan stint with Real Sociedad and it looked like he could become a first-team player for Zidane. But he has found himself short of opportunities after starting in the first two La Liga games of the season. Odegaard will now be looking to improve himself further in this stint with Arsenal.

The Gunners are currently placed ninth in the Premier League table. They didn’t have a good start to the season but they have turned their fortunes around in recent times. Arsenal are now unbeaten in their last five Premier League games and now they will be looking to stretch that run further.
